如何实现VPN快速连接?网络工程师教你优化方案与常见问题排查

admin11 2026-01-16 VPN梯子 2 0

在当今远程办公、跨国协作日益普及的背景下,虚拟私人网络(VPN)已成为企业和个人用户保障网络安全和访问权限的核心工具,许多用户常遇到“连接慢”“频繁断线”或“无法建立隧道”的问题,严重影响工作效率,作为一名资深网络工程师,我将从技术原理出发,为你梳理实现VPN快速连接的关键策略与常见故障排查方法。

理解什么是“快速连接”,这里的“快”,不仅指建立隧道的速度(通常在几秒内完成),还包含数据传输延迟低、带宽利用率高、稳定性强,要实现这一点,必须从以下几个方面入手:

  1. 选择合适的协议
    常见的VPN协议包括PPTP、L2TP/IPsec、OpenVPN和WireGuard,WireGuard是近年来最受推崇的新一代协议,因其轻量级设计和高性能著称,相比OpenVPN动辄数百毫秒的握手时间,WireGuard可在100ms内完成连接,且对CPU资源占用极低,如果你使用的是Linux或现代移动设备,建议优先启用WireGuard协议。

  2. 优化服务器位置与负载均衡
    连接速度受物理距离影响显著,中国用户若连接美国服务器,即使网络带宽充足,也会因路由延迟(RTT)导致卡顿,此时应优先选择地理位置相近的节点(如亚洲地区服务器),企业级部署可引入CDN加速节点,通过智能DNS调度自动分配最优服务器地址,合理配置负载均衡器,避免单点过载,能有效提升并发连接性能。

  3. 调整MTU值与TCP窗口大小
    不同网络环境下,MTU(最大传输单元)设置不当会导致分片丢包,进而引发重传和延迟,可通过ping命令测试路径MTU:ping -f -l 1472 <目标IP>,若提示“需要分割数据包”,则说明当前MTU过大,建议将客户端MTU设为1400-1450,服务器端同步调整,针对高延迟链路,增大TCP窗口大小(如从64KB调至256KB)可提升吞吐量。

  4. 防火墙与NAT穿透优化
    许多家庭宽带或企业防火墙会阻断UDP端口(如OpenVPN默认使用的1194),导致连接失败,解决方案包括:

    • 使用TCP模式替代UDP(牺牲部分速度换兼容性)
    • 在路由器上开启UPnP或手动映射端口
    • 启用“Keep-Alive”机制防止空闲超时断开
  5. 客户端与服务端日志分析
    当连接异常时,不要仅凭主观感受判断,Windows系统可查看事件查看器中的“Microsoft-Windows-Vpn/Operational”日志;Linux则通过journalctl -u openvpn@client.service定位错误码(如ECONNREFUSED表示端口不通,EAGAIN表示资源不足),这些日志能快速定位是配置问题、认证失败还是链路中断。

定期维护同样重要,建议每月检查一次证书有效期(过期会导致连接中断)、更新固件(修复已知漏洞)、并进行压力测试(模拟多用户并发登录),对于企业环境,还可部署集中式日志管理系统(如ELK Stack),实时监控各节点状态。

实现VPN快速连接并非一蹴而就,而是需要综合协议选择、拓扑优化、参数调优与持续运维的系统工程,掌握上述技巧,你将告别“等半天才连上”的烦恼,真正享受高效、安全的远程接入体验。

如何实现VPN快速连接?网络工程师教你优化方案与常见问题排查